Frequently Asked Questions About Printable Star Templates
This section addresses common inquiries concerning the usage, sourcing, and modification of star-shaped outlines intended for printing.
Question 1: What types of file formats are commonly available?
Common file formats include PDF, JPEG, PNG, and occasionally vector-based formats like SVG or EPS. PDF files are often preferred for their print-ready nature and consistent formatting across different devices. Image files are suitable for importing into graphic design software.
Question 2: Where can one locate these resources?
Numerous websites offer these resources, including online crafting sites, educational resource portals, and graphic design marketplaces. It is advisable to verify the licensing terms before use, particularly for commercial purposes.
Question 3: Can the size be adjusted prior to printing?
Yes, the size is generally adjustable. Image editing software or PDF viewers often include options to scale the image or document before printing. Vector-based files allow for resizing without loss of quality.
Question 4: Are these templates suitable for commercial use?
The suitability for commercial use depends on the license associated with the design. Some resources are offered under licenses that permit commercial adaptation and distribution, while others are restricted to personal use only. It is essential to review the terms and conditions.
Question 5: What materials are best suited for printing?
The choice of material depends on the intended application. Standard printer paper is suitable for general crafts. Cardstock or heavier paper weights are recommended for more durable templates. Adhesive-backed paper is useful for creating stickers or labels.
Question 6: Is it possible to customize these templates?
Customization is possible using graphic design software. Users can modify the shape, size, add text, or incorporate other design elements. The extent of customization depends on the file format and the capabilities of the software.

Tips for Optimal Utilization of Printable Star Templates
This section presents strategies for maximizing the effectiveness and versatility of digitally available star-shaped outlines when used in various projects.
Tip 1: Select the Appropriate File Format: Prioritize vector-based formats such as SVG or EPS when scalability is required. These formats allow for resizing without pixelation, ensuring crisp lines regardless of output size. PDF files offer a balance of convenience and quality for general printing purposes.
Tip 2: Adjust Print Settings for Accuracy: Before printing, verify that the printer settings are configured to “actual size” or 100% scale. This prevents unintended distortion or resizing of the design, ensuring accurate dimensions for subsequent use.
Tip 3: Employ a Variety of Paper Weights: Consider the end application when choosing paper. Thicker cardstock provides durability for templates that will be repeatedly handled or used as stencils. Standard printer paper suffices for temporary patterns or decorative elements.
Tip 4: Utilize Image Editing Software for Customization: Import the template into a program like Adobe Illustrator or GIMP to modify its appearance. Options include altering the star’s number of points, adjusting proportions, and adding internal details or textures.
Tip 5: Create Multi-Sized Sets for Versatility: Print the same template at different scales to generate a range of sizes. This provides flexibility when working on projects with varying dimensional requirements, eliminating the need to repeatedly search for new resources.
Tip 6: Print on Adhesive-Backed Paper for Stickers: For applications requiring adhesive backing, print directly onto sticker paper. This simplifies the creation of custom star-shaped stickers for labeling, decoration, or craft projects.
Tip 7: Trace Onto Desired Materials for Cutting: After printing, trace the template onto materials like fabric, wood, or metal for cutting. Secure the template firmly to prevent slippage during the tracing process, ensuring accurate replication of the star shape.
